    99% of any 2.4 overheating issues are its already got a cracked head, people try for week and months to try different things, you can hide it, make it slightly better, but the first long trip down the motorway and it'll dump all its water.

    The damage has been done long ago, its only overheating now because the overpressured coolant is getting dumped out of the expansion bottle till there isn't enough left to cool the motor, then it gets hot.

    They arn't that hard to fill with coolant, most people think they have airlocks, but its already fawked and dumping coolant, thats all.

    Chucking the coolant out through the expansion bottle is a sign of exhaust gases entering the collant system, generally caused by a cracked head.

    In your situation I would get the truck checked.
    Basic and simple test is to start the truck (when it is cold) with the radiator cap off, the coolant should not raise above the rim until the system is up to temperature. Alternatively you could get the system sniffer tested (you'd need to ask a mechanic about this).
